在Vue.js中定义公共常量的最佳方法?\[关闭\]

vue.js Vue.js

达蒙猪猪

2020-03-11

我正在使用单个文件组件开发几个Vue应用程序。我发现我的很多组件都需要通用的配置信息,例如,一个包含交付方法的对象,我可以这样定义:

const DeliveryMethods = {
  DELIVERY: "Delivery",
  CARRIER: "Carrier",
  COLLATION: "Collation",
  CASH_AND_CARRY: "Cash and carry"
}

将其提供给我的组件的最简单,最简单的方法是什么?目前,我已经使用文件“ config.js”完成了该操作,如下所示:

export default {

  DeliveryMethods: {
    DELIVERY: "Delivery",
    CARRIER: "Carrier",
    COLLATION: "Collation",
    CASH_AND_CARRY: "Cash and carry"
  }

}

在我需要的组件中import config from 'src/config.js',我想要使用的组件中有一个,我将引用例如config.DeliveryMethods.CASH_AND_CARRY但是,在我看来,这是漫长而重复的,而且我更希望能够使用just DeliveryMethods.CASH_AND_CARRY代替config.DeliveryMethods.CASH_AND_CARRY别人用什么来做到这一点?

第806篇《在Vue.js中定义公共常量的最佳方法?\[关闭\]》来自Winter(https://github.com/aiyld/aiyld.github.io)的站点

0个回答

问题类别

JavaScript Ckeditor Python Webpack TypeScript Vue.js React.js ExpressJS KoaJS CSS Node.js HTML Django 单元测试 PHP Asp.net jQuery Bootstrap IOS Android